Remote Software Engineer Intern — Build Data in Motion
Remote Software Engineer Intern — Build Data in Motion

Remote Software Engineer Intern — Build Data in Motion

Internship 500 - 1500 £ / month (est.) Home office possible
Confluent

At a Glance

  • Tasks: Design and develop software for real-time data processing in a remote internship.
  • Company: Leading data streaming company with a vibrant culture.
  • Benefits: Gain hands-on experience, enhance coding skills, and work remotely.
  • Why this job: Join an innovative team and make an impact in the world of data.
  • Qualifications: Pursuing a degree in Computer Science or related field, with programming skills.
  • Other info: Full-year internship with opportunities for growth and learning.

The predicted salary is between 500 - 1500 £ per month.

A leading data streaming company offers a remote placement internship for a full year. The ideal candidate is pursuing a Bachelor's or Master's in Computer Science or a related field.

Responsibilities include:

  • Designing, developing, and maintaining software with a focus on real-time data processing.

The position demands strong communication skills, proficiency in a programming language, and a passion for distributed systems. This role provides a unique opportunity to experience the company's culture and enhance coding skills in an innovative environment.

Remote Software Engineer Intern — Build Data in Motion employer: Confluent

As a leading data streaming company, we pride ourselves on fostering a dynamic and inclusive work culture that encourages innovation and collaboration. Our remote Software Engineer Intern position offers not only the chance to work on cutting-edge technology but also ample opportunities for personal and professional growth, all while enjoying the flexibility of a remote work environment. Join us to enhance your coding skills and be part of a team that values creativity and forward-thinking in the ever-evolving tech landscape.
Confluent

Contact Detail:

Confluent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Remote Software Engineer Intern — Build Data in Motion

Tip Number 1

Network like a pro! Reach out to current or former interns and employees on LinkedIn. Ask them about their experiences and any tips they might have for landing the role.

Tip Number 2

Show off your skills! Create a GitHub repository showcasing your projects, especially those related to real-time data processing. This gives us a glimpse of your coding abilities and passion for distributed systems.

Tip Number 3

Prepare for the interview by brushing up on your programming languages and data structures. We love candidates who can think on their feet, so practice coding challenges to sharpen your problem-solving skills.

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ets noticed. Plus, it shows you’re genuinely interested in joining our innovative team.

We think you need these skills to ace Remote Software Engineer Intern — Build Data in Motion

Real-time Data Processing
Software Design
Software Development
Software Maintenance
Proficiency in a Programming Language
Distributed Systems
Communication Skills
Coding Skills

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ant skills and experiences that align with the role. We want to see your passion for real-time data processing and distributed systems, so don’t hold back!

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re excited about this internship and how your background in Computer Science makes you a great fit for our team.

Show Off Your Coding Skills: If you’ve worked on any projects or have coding samples, include them! We love seeing practical examples of your work, especially if they relate to data streaming or software development.

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ates from our team!

How to prepare for a job interview at Confluent

Know Your Tech Stack

Make sure you’re familiar with the programming languages and tools mentioned in the job description. Brush up on your coding skills, especially in real-time data processing, as you might be asked to solve problems or write code during the interview.

Show Your Passion for Distributed Systems

Be prepared to discuss your interest in distributed systems and any relevant projects you've worked on. Sharing specific examples of how you've tackled challenges in this area can really impress the interviewers and show that you're genuinely excited about the role.

Communicate Clearly

Strong communication skills are key for this position. Practice explaining your thought process when solving technical problems. This not only demonstrates your technical knowledge but also shows that you can articulate complex ideas clearly, which is crucial in a remote setting.

Research the Company Culture

Take some time to understand the company’s culture and values. Being able to align your personal values with theirs can set you apart. Prepare questions that reflect your interest in their work environment and how you can contribute positively to their team.

Remote Software Engineer Intern — Build Data in Motion
Confluent

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

>